WebProcedures for charging a battery: Charge batteries in a designated, well-ventilated area. Do not attempt to recharge a frozen or damaged battery. Follow the manufacturer’s recommendations for charging rates, connections and vent plug adjustment. WebDec 7, 2024 · Aviva is warning customers to take care when charging electrical items, after receiving dozens of home fire claims caused by chargers and batteries in 2024. According to the insurer, multiple home fire claims this year have been linked to faulty, damaged or incorrect chargers, or items which were left to charge for too long.
